Garlic Butter Steak Bites with Parmesan Cream Sauce recipe

Ingredients:

For the Steak Bites:

• 1 lb (450g) sirloin steak, cut into bite-sized pieces

• Salt and black pepper, to taste

• 2 tbsp (28g) butter

• 5 cloves garlic, minced

For the Parmesan Cream Sauce:

• ½ cup (120ml) beef broth

• 1 cup (240ml) heavy cream

• ½ cup (50g) grated Parmesan cheese

• 1 tbsp fresh parsley, chopped (optional, for garnish)

Instructions:

1. Prepare the Steak Bites:

1. Season the steak pieces generously with salt and black pepper.

2. In a large skillet, melt butter over medium-high heat. Add the steak bites in a single layer and cook for 2-3 minutes on each side, or until golden brown and cooked to your desired doneness. Remove the steak bites and set aside.

2. Make the Garlic Butter Sauce:

1. In the same skillet, add the minced garlic to the remaining butter and sauté for 30 seconds, or until fragrant.

2. Pour in the beef broth, scraping up any browned bits from the bottom of the skillet.

3. Create the Parmesan Cream Sauce:

1. Reduce the heat to medium-low. Slowly stir in the heavy cream and Parmesan cheese, whisking until the sauce thickens (about 2-3 minutes). Adjust seasoning with salt and pepper as needed.

4. Combine and Serve:

1. Return the steak bites to the skillet, tossing them in the creamy garlic sauce.

2. Garnish with freshly chopped parsley and serve immediately.

Tips for Success:

• Choose the Right Cut: Sirloin is ideal, but you can also use ribeye or tenderloin for an extra luxurious touch.

• Don’t Overcrowd the Pan: Cook the steak bites in batches if necessary to ensure they sear properly.

• Storage: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Reheat gently to avoid overcooking the steak.
